# MAX_SOLVER_ITERATIONS
#
# Heads up, support folks: this caps how long the Chalkwright
# timetable solver grinds before giving up on a school's schedule.
# When a customer says "my timetable never finishes," nine times
# out of ten they've hit this ceiling because of contradictory
# room constraints, not a bug. Raising it rarely helps — it just
# delays the same failure. Instead, ask them to loosen the
# constraints flagged in the solver report. When escalating,
# always include the build token that appears below.

pipeline stamp: htk9_6ce9d33c5

## Deployment

The Lumacache image service has a known slow leak in its thumbnail cache layer: evicted entries keep a reference alive through the decoder pool, so resident memory creeps up roughly 40 MB per hour under steady load. Until the refactor in the Harkness branch lands, we mitigate by capping pool size and scheduling a rolling restart every 12 hours. Deploy with the supervisor, never bare, or the restart hook won't fire. The deployment relies on the configuration values listed below.

settings of bagug-tahof:
holath:
  pin: 7837
  metrics_host: metrics.holath.tolvaqsys.internal
  tenant: quenath
  seal: seal_6001b3af

This PR reworks the nightly reindex for Querrel so plugin-provided fields stop getting dropped. Previously we rebuilt the whole index in one pass, and any plugin that registered custom analyzers after the snapshot got silently ignored. Now we chunk the rebuild, re-read plugin registrations per chunk, and retry failed batches with backoff. Plugin authors shouldn't need code changes, but heavy custom tokenizers may want to adjust batch sizing. Defaults we landed on after benchmarking are as follows.

tuning table, yajog-yahof:
BUDGETS = {
    "lamvan": 303,
    "wenox": 460,
    "fenvan": 525,
}

ProseGate, our documentation linter, exposes a single REST endpoint for lint runs. Fire a POST with your doc bundle and you'll get back a list of style violations, sorted by severity. All requests need the internal service key in the auth header — without it you'll just get 401s. The current key follows.

service key, kawip-kahop: kto4_QQzB